CVE-2025-38498
Linux Kernel Mount Namespace Permission Bypass Vulnerability
Description

In the Linux kernel, the following vulnerability has been resolved: do_change_type(): refuse to operate on unmounted/not ours mounts Ensure that propagation settings can only be changed for mounts located in the caller's mount namespace. This change aligns permission checking with the rest of mount(2).
